The Man Behind the Magic: Cooper's Background
Before we dive into the dance with the devil lyrics, let's first meet the mastermind behind them. Alice Cooper, born Vincent Damon Furnier, is an American singer, songwriter, and musician whose career spans over five decades. Known for his theatrical stage presence and elaborate performances, Cooper is widely regarded as the pioneer of shock rock. Now that we've got our bearings, let's dance with the devil, shall we?
